Mask
I wear this figurative mask
Every day of my life
It paints a picture of happiness
Instead of anxiety, stress n dislike
It shades me from the world
And shades the world from me
Wearing the mask protects myself
From all the disappointment that roams free
That mask allows for freedom
And I can be whomever I want to be
Hiding behind the mask I can be anybody
Its powerful nature is inexplicable
It holds such a forceful being
It saves me from reality
And hides my true feelings
The mask is a place holder
For all I feel inside my heart
It protects me from the truth
And all the judgment that tears me apart
